    Where's Armaldo?

    On the next island, Ash & Co. are shocked to find that some thought-to-be extinct Pokémon live on it. They discover this is a haven for them ran by a couple of scientists. However when an Armaldo goes a bit beserk, it causes trouble...and to make things worse, Team Rocket wants it...
